Detailed analysis of the Volvo S60 2.4D Kinetic Aut. · 163 CV (2004-2008)
General description
The 2001 Volvo S60, in its 2.4D Kinetic Aut. version, represents the essence of the Swedish sedan, combining a sober aesthetic with a clear focus on safety and comfort. This model, with its 163 HP diesel engine and automatic transmission, positions itself as a robust and reliable option for those seeking a classic-cut vehicle but with adequate performance for daily use and long journeys.
Driving experience
Behind the wheel of the S60, the predominant feeling is one of solidity and composure. The 2.4-liter diesel engine, with its 163 HP, offers a powerful response and a torque of 340 Nm that is felt from low revolutions, allowing for safe overtakes and relaxed driving on the highway. The 5-speed automatic gearbox, although not the fastest on the market, performs its function smoothly, prioritizing comfort. The suspension, McPherson type at the front and deformable parallelogram at the rear, effectively filters out road irregularities, contributing to a pleasant journey. The rack-and-pinion steering transmits a good sense of control, though without the agility of some of its sportier competitors. In general, the S60 invites calm and safe driving, where the comfort of the occupants is the priority.
Design and aesthetics
The design of the 2001 Volvo S60 is a clear example of Scandinavian philosophy: clean, elegant, and timeless lines. Its four-door body, with a length of 4603 mm, a width of 1804 mm, and a height of 1428 mm, gives it a distinguished presence on the road. The front, with its characteristic headlights and central grille, projects an image of robustness. The rear, with its vertical taillights, is unmistakably Volvo. Inside, sobriety and ergonomics are key. The good quality materials and careful finishes create a cozy and functional atmosphere. The seats, especially the front ones, are famous for their comfort and support, even on long journeys. The trunk, with 424 liters, offers sufficient space for a family's luggage.
Technology and features
Although the 2001 Volvo S60 does not incorporate the latest technological innovations of current vehicles, it does have elements that, for its time, were advanced and contributed to safety and comfort. The 2.4-liter diesel engine, with common rail direct injection, variable geometry turbo, and intercooler, was an efficient and powerful engine. The 5-speed automatic transmission, although not a dual-clutch, offered smooth driving. In terms of safety, Volvo has always been a pioneer, and this S60 is no exception, incorporating advanced braking systems with ventilated front discs and rear discs, as well as a body structure designed to protect occupants in the event of an impact. Power steering and stability control (although not explicitly specified, it was common in Volvo) contributed to safer driving.
Competition
In the premium sedan segment of its time, the Volvo S60 2.4D Kinetic Aut. faced tough competitors such as the BMW 3 Series, the Mercedes-Benz C-Class, and the Audi A4. Compared to them, the S60 offered a different proposition, prioritizing safety, comfort, and a more discreet and elegant aesthetic. While German rivals might stand out for greater sportiness or more ostentatious luxury, the Volvo positioned itself as a more rational and safe alternative, ideal for those who valued tranquility and reliability above all else. Its powerful and efficient diesel engine allowed it to compete in performance with its counterparts, maintaining a combined consumption of 7.5 l/100km.
